NEW YORK, Jan. 18 (UPI) -- Hollywood actor George Clooney has been named a United Nations "messenger of peace" because of his humanitarian work, People.com reported Friday.
Clooney, who raises money for those suffering in Darfur and increases awareness about the crisis affecting the region, is being "recognized for focusing public attention on crucial international political and social issues," U.N. spokeswoman Michele Montas told the magazine.
Clooney and his frequent on-screen collaborator, Don Cheadle, received the Peace Summit Award by a group of Nobel Laureates last month for their work for Darfur, a region in western Sudan.
